- The distance between Birmingham, England, Uk and Kita, Mali is approximately 4,439 km or 2,759 mi.
- To reach Birmingham, England in this distance one would set out from Kita bearing 7.4°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Birmingham, England bearing 11.8° or NNE .
- Birmingham, England has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Kita has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Birmingham, England is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ome whereas Kita is in or near the tropical dry for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 19.1 °C (34.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 5.7 °C (10.3°F) more in Birmingham, England.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 250.6 mm (9.9 in) less which is equivalent to 250.6 l/m² (6.15 US gal/ft²) or 2,506,000 l/ha (267,908 US gal/ac) less. About 5/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 35.1° lower in Birmingham, England than in Kita.
